Olympus Service Repair Centers
Home >> Olympus Service Centers >> Olympus Service Centers Montana
Olympus Service Centers in Great Falls
↓↓↓ Look addresses below ↓↓↓
Olympus technical support center in Great Falls, Montana
- Walmart
701 Smelter Ave Ne
Great Falls, MT 59404
Distance: 1.0 miles - Radioshack
HOLIDAY VILLAGE SHOP CTR
GREAT FALLS, MT 59405
Distance: 1.5 miles - Staples
207 NorthWest Bypass
Great Falls, MT 59404
Distance: 1.5 miles - Sears
1200 10TH AVE S
GREAT FALLS, MT 59405
Distance: 1.5 miles - Sears
1200 10TH AVE S
GREAT FALLS, MT
Distance: 1.5 miles
Support for Olympus products
Phone: (800) 622-6372
Zip Code: 59401